2.2 Predetermined Pay-out – The Client will receive a predetermined pay-out if their Cryptocurrency option transaction expires in-the-money, and he will lose a predetermined amount of his investment on the Transaction if the option expires out-of-the-money. The predetermined amounts are a derivative of the collateral invested in the transaction by the Client, and will be published on the Trading Platform. The degree to which the option is in-the-money or out-of-the-money does not matter as it does with traditional options.

2.6 Cancel Feature Abuse – The Company offers a special cancellation feature that allows traders to cancel a trade within a few seconds of execution. Abuse of the cancellation feature can be considered market arbitrage and can result in forfeiture of profits. Company reserves the right to cancel a position if the cancellation feature is abused. The acceptable cancellation percentage cannot exceed 20% of the total number of executed trades. Cancelling more than 20% of the total number of executed trades is considered abuse of this feature and resulting profits may be forfeited from such abuse.

Trading in Cryptocurrency Options and digital assets is considered a highly risky and speculative investment venue.
The relevant markets for trading are characterized as highly volatile markets, which inherits high risk in evaluating the outcome of a Cryptocurrency option. The Company is not and will not, in any way, be responsible for the outcome of any transaction executed by the Client.
CAUTION: Clients should never fund their trading activities with retirement savings, loans, mortgages, emergency funds, funds set aside for purposes such as education or home ownership, or funds required for current income or present or future medical expenses.
